Where does the product marketing process start? We should consider the Triggers that engage a marketer into action.
There are Macro triggers:
- Management Directive, or
- Planning cycle
- Competitive moves
- Government / industry legislation (Patriot Act, SOX, etc)
- Industry growth / consolidation
There are Micro triggers:
- New product launch / new version release
- Segmentation / targeting / positioning effort
- Campaign / activity success
- Campaign / activity failure
- Customer feedback
Each of these triggers will start a process - some of these processes will be planned (Go To Market planning) some will not (competitive campaigns) but all will need to feed into an overall process map that will be flexible enough to manage change.
